Characteristic Females with body short, globular; mouth large, cleft extending past eye, oblique or vertical; eye small; illicium short; esca simple, with conical distal end but no crest; anterior margin of vomer very concave; skin covered with tiny close-set dermal spinules, appearing naked; upper and lower jaws with numerous slender, recurved and depressible teeth; vomerine teeth present; dark brown to black over entire surface of head, body, fins, and oral cavity; sphenotic spines absent. D10-13; P 14-16; A 4; C 9. Upper jaw teeth 37-56, lower jaw teeth 46-122. Measurement in % SL: illicium length 34.5, escal width 3.9%, head length 27.6, head depth 45.7, premaxillary length 34.5, lower jaws 34.5, the narrowest distance between front 13.8%.
habitats Marine. First dorsal spine of female highly modified into a long rod with a light organ in the tip call illicium and esca, the esca containing bacteria as luminous symbiont, its function in attracting prey. Oviparous, larvae habits in the upper, food-rich 
Distribution Wistly distributed in the tropical to temperate of all oceans. It is a common species in Taiwan occurring in northeast off Yilan. 
Utility No commercial value.
